1.0 INTRODUCTION
During July and August, 1986, the Magpie River project area was mapped at a scale of 1:5000 using the claim lines and an airphoto mosaic for control.
A grid was subsequently established north of Legarde Lake over an auriferous zone hosted in felsic volcanics. Samples from trenching returned anomalous gold values including a 3m section of 1.32 g/t and a 1m section of 4.46 g/t.
2.0 LOCATION AND ACCESS (Figure 1)
The Magpie River Project covers Bailloquet and Lendrum Townships near Wawa and Canada Highway.

Access to the central and eastern portion of the claims is best achieved along the Algoma Central Railway (ACR) or by vehicle along the Steephill Falls road which follows the Magpie River to Siderite Junction.
3.0 PROPERTY DESCRIPTION (Figure 2)
The Magpie River Project consists of one hundred and eight (108) unpatented mining claims in two blocks and one single claim near Mink Lake. The property comprises approximately 1750 hectares in southeastern Chabanel, northwestern Bailloquet and north-central Lendrum Townships (Claim Maps G.2744, G.2394 and G.2785) in the Sault Ste. Marie Mining Division. The claims are recorded in the name of Noranda Exploration Company, Limited and numbered as follows:

4.0 PREVIOUS WORK
4. l Magpie River Area
Gold was first discovered in the Magpie River area during the late 1920's and early 1930's by local prospectors. One of the prospects, the Mun-Williamson near Mink Lake, was eventually drill tested by J. Errington in 1936. Ten shallow holes were drilled. Partial assay results on file include an 8.5m intersection of 3.12 g/t.
In 1981, Algoma Ore staked several claims bordering on the northeast corner of the Gros Cap Indian Reservation to cover several airborne EM anomalies. Geological mapping and ground geophysical surveys (VLF-EM and Magnetometer) outlined two subparallel bands of sulphide-bearing iron formation capping a cycle of mafic-felsic volcanism. Three diamond drill holes (338m) tested the two bands of iron formation. Examination of the core showed that the upper band is associated with silicified tuffs and quartz-eye muscovite schist (locally with green mica). Sections of the core were assayed for gold and base metals with negative results.
The Mildred Iron Range which outcrops on a large hill east of the Trans-Canada Highway, was staked by A. Guetz in 1906. Jalore Mining optioned the property in 1948 and carried out diamond drilling, magnetic and gravity surveys. The option was abandoned in 1951 because the iron formation contained a low (00/5) percentage of iron. No assays or reports regarding the property's gold or base metal potential could be located in the assessment files or on record with Algoma Ore, the present land holders.
Hemgold Resources (now known as Hydro Home Appliance) staked much of the ground which is now part of the Magpie River Project in 1983. An airborne survey, contracted to Aerodat, was flown. No ground follow-up was done.
4.2 Lagarde Lake Area
A gold prospect at Lagarde Lake was examined during the 1930's by a series of trenches over a strike length of 270ra. The Lagarde Lake showing, known previously as the Boliden Syndicate and the Mun-Williamson Prospect, was examined by Erie Canada and Hollinger in 1936. Chip samples taken by Erie Canada along the trenches generally returned low values, although a 2.6m section reportedly assayed 2.4 g/t Au.
4.3 Mink Lake Area
Hemgold Resources staked the Mink Lake prospect in 1983. A geophysical program (VLF-EM and Magnetometer) was completed by H. Ferderber Geophysics Ltd.
5.0 REGIONAL GEOLOGY
The Magpie River Project lies within the Archean Wawa Greenstone Belt, part of the Abitibi-Wawa-Shebandowan subprovince of the Canadian Shield. The property lies along the south limb of a major ENE-trending sedimentary basin which can be traced from Michipicoten on the shore of Lake Superior to Hawk Junction.
The area is underlain by a metavolcanic assemblage occurring stratigraphically above the Helen, Eleanor, Lucy and Mildred Iron Ranges. The sequence consists of high Fe-tholeiitic basalts, calc- alkaline intermediate-felsic volcanics locally capped by a hematite- oagnetite iron formation. The volcanic sequence is overlain and locally eroded by a turbidite sedimentary sequence consisting of argillites, wackes and conglomerates. Local fluviatile sedimentation is preserved.
Supracrustal rocks in the area have been metamorphosed to the upper greenschist facies. The volcanic rocks have been intruded by several major early Precambrian gabbroic bodies and the entire sequence has been intruded by mid to late Precambrian diabase dykes and Proterozoic alkaline lamprophyres.
6.0 WORK PERFORMED - 1986
6.1 Claim Line Geology (Maps l and 2)
The Magpie River claim group was mapped on a scale of 1:5,000 along the existing claim lines using an airphoto mosaic for control. Exposure in the eastern portion of the claims is excellent due to the absence of vegetation and soil cover. A detailed legend for the Wawa area is presented as Appendix I. Assays and whole rock geochemistry for the area is provided as Appendix II.
The project area is underlain predominantly by intermediate- felsic pyroclastics and possible synvolcanic intrusive equivalents which have been intruded by a diorite complex.
Timiskaming metasediments, including conglomerate, wacke and argillite underlie the northern portion of the claim group. Iron formation occurs within the volcanic sequence but is more commonly associated with the volcanic-sedimentary contact.
6.2 Grid Establishment
A small grid totaling 4.6 kms was established north of Lagarde Lake on claims SSM 884990, 884991 and 884993 to cover a stratiform auriferous zone hosted in felsic volcanics.
The baseline was run at an azimuth of H48E with grid lines every 50m.
6.3 Detailed Geology - Cardiac Hill (Map 3)
Detailed mapping on a scale of 1:1,000 and trenching was carried out on the Cardiac Hill grid. The dominant rock types in the grid area are intermediate-felsic volcanics; including, spherulitic flows, coarse agglomerates and finely laminated tuffs. Massive quartz- eye bearing units occur as conformable "sill-like" lenses within the volcanic sequence.
A thin brecciated band of chert-magnetite iron formation which can be traced between lines 3+OOE and 4+OOE, appears to be on strike of a 5-10m wide gossan zone that outcrops on lines 4+50E and 5+OOE. The gossan zone is hosted by a sheared, carbonate-rich unit containing abundant green mica.
Mafic volcanics outcrop on the northern section of the gridarea. Pillowed flows, pillow breccia and medium to coarse-grainedmassive flows or intrusives characterize the mafic volcanic sequence.
The mafic volcanics are overlain by conglomerates, wackes and argillites.
Gold mineralization is related to gossanous zones along the contact between the coarse agglomerate and spherulitic flows. Eight trenches were placed along the spherulitic-agglomerate contact, and another two trenches sampled the iron formation.
Assay results included a section of 1.32 g/t over 3m in Trench l and 1m of 4.56 g/t in Trench 4.
7.0 RECOMMENDATIONS
1) A grid should be established over the western portion of the claim group along the volcanic-sedimentary contact. Ground HLEM and proton magnetometer surveys are recommended to delineate the sulphide-bearing iron formation.
2) Detailed geological mapping and soil geochemistry should be carried out over the grid.
3) Additional mapping and prospecting is warranted near Lagarde Lake in the vicinity of the Cardiac Hill showing.
